Aviators captured the attention of the American people through a combination of daring feats and pioneering innovations in aviation. High-profile events, such as Charles Lindbergh's historic solo transatlantic flight in 1927, captivated the public's imagination and symbolized the spirit of adventure and progress. Additionally, aviators became media celebrities, with their exploits widely covered in newspapers and films, further fueling public fascination. Their contributions to both military and commercial aviation also highlighted the transformative potential of flight, solidifying their status as national heroes.
